Cyber Security in Bangalore’s FinTech Industry

Bangalore has evolved into a thriving hub for financial technology (FinTech) innovation. With startups and established financial institutions leveraging advanced technologies such as artificial intelligence, blockchain, and digital payments, the ecosystem has experienced exponential growth. However, this rapid digital transformation has also introduced significant cyber security challenges. As financial data becomes increasingly digitized, protecting sensitive information and maintaining trust has become a critical priority for organizations operating in this sector.

The Rise of FinTech in Bangalore

Over the past decade, Bangalore has attracted a wide range of FinTech companies focusing on payments, lending, wealth management, and insurance technology. Government initiatives like Digital India and the widespread adoption of UPI have accelerated this growth. The convenience offered by digital platforms has led to a surge in online transactions, making the FinTech ecosystem both lucrative and vulnerable.

With increased digital adoption comes a broader attack surface. Cybercriminals are constantly evolving their tactics, targeting financial platforms to exploit vulnerabilities. As a result, cyber security is no longer just an IT concern but a core business requirement.

Key Cyber Security Threats in the FinTech Sector

FinTech companies in Bangalore face a variety of cyber threats, including:

1. Phishing Attacks

Fraudsters use deceptive emails, messages, or websites to trick users into sharing sensitive information such as login credentials or banking details.

2. Data Breaches

Unauthorized access to databases can expose customer information, leading to financial losses and reputational damage.

3. Ransomware Attacks

Attackers encrypt critical data and demand payment for its release, disrupting operations and causing financial strain.

4. API Vulnerabilities

FinTech platforms rely heavily on APIs for integration. Poorly secured APIs can serve as entry points for attackers.

5. Insider Threats

Employees or contractors with access to sensitive data may intentionally or unintentionally compromise security.

Regulatory Landscape and Compliance

To address these challenges, regulatory bodies such as the Reserve Bank of India (RBI) have introduced strict guidelines for data protection, digital payments security, and IT governance. FinTech companies must comply with standards like:

  • Data localization requirements
  • Secure authentication protocols
  • Regular security audits
  • Incident response mechanisms

Compliance is not just about avoiding penalties, it is essential for building customer trust and ensuring long-term sustainability.

Technologies Strengthening Cyber Security

To combat evolving threats, FinTech companies in Bangalore are adopting advanced technologies, including:

Artificial Intelligence and Machine Learning

AI-driven systems can detect anomalies in transaction patterns and identify potential fraud in real time.

Blockchain Technology

Blockchain enhances transparency and security by creating immutable transaction records.

Multi-Factor Authentication (MFA)

Adding multiple layers of verification significantly reduces the risk of unauthorized access.

Encryption Techniques

End-to-end encryption ensures that sensitive data remains secure during transmission and storage.

Zero Trust Architecture

This model assumes that no user or system is inherently trustworthy, enforcing strict verification at every access point.

Role of Startups and Innovation

Bangalore’s startup ecosystem plays a crucial role in driving cyber security innovation. Many startups specialize in niche areas such as fraud detection, identity verification, and cloud security. These companies collaborate with FinTech firms to provide tailored security solutions.

The presence of incubators, accelerators, and venture capital funding further supports the development of cutting-edge security technologies. This collaborative environment fosters continuous improvement and resilience against cyber threats.

Cyber Security Challenges and Future Outlook

Despite advancements, several challenges persist:

  • Shortage of skilled professionals
  • Rapidly evolving threat landscape
  • Balancing innovation with security
  • High cost of implementing advanced security measures

Looking ahead, the future of cyber security in Bangalore’s FinTech industry will be shaped by increased automation, regulatory evolution, and greater collaboration between public and private sectors. As cyber threats become more sophisticated, organizations must adopt proactive strategies rather than reactive measures.
